What is FEMA Hydrology Review
The FEMA Hydrology Review Form is an application form used by independent review engineers to verify hydrologic studies for FEMA floodplain mapping.

Who is eligible to use the FEMA Hydrology Review Form?
The FEMA Hydrology Review Form is intended for independent quality assurance review engineers and FEMA staff involved in hydrologic studies and floodplain management.

What supporting documents do I need to include with the form?
Supporting documents may include prior hydrologic studies, watershed data, and any relevant hydrological models or calculations that support the verification process.
